Position Summary 

Under the supervision of the Community Programs Director, the Recreation Specialist is responsible for planning, organizing, and implementing engaging recreational activities for youth at both after-school program sites and YMCA branch locations. This role focuses on promoting physical activity, social connection, and personal growth while ensuring a safe, welcoming, and inclusive environment for all participants.

Qualifications 

  • 18+ years or older 
  • Associate’s degree or higher, or High School diploma/equivalent with one of the following:  
  • 48+ completed college units (verified by transcript),  
  • Passing score on the CA Basic Education Skills Test (CBEST), or  
  • Passing score on a District Instructional Aide Exam. 
  • Proficient in leading physical activities with youth. 
  • Must be available: Monday-Friday, between 1:00-6:00 pm for scheduled enrichments. 
  • Able to supervise and mentor youth. 
  • TB Test clearance within last 2 years.
